Responsibilities and day-to-day activities.



This role will be working closely with the Managing Director taking on the day to day management and decision making and turning ideas into life. The role is split into two key areas as set out below:

1. HR management

Recruitment and onboarding Leading, managing and holding employees accountable for delivering in their roles Manage training and employee development Managing rotas, holidays and absences Disciplinary and dismissals Weekly reviews, quarterly 1-1's and annual reviews Organising team initiatives such as christmas parties, days out and facilitating employee recognition and reward schemes
2. Office management and administration

Integrating and streamlining processes and business systems to enable to business to continue to grow without bottlenecks Document control - ensuring all documents, systems and processes are logged on a document control schedule and reviewed periodically Organising inspection, stocking and maintenance of company vehicles Organising planned and reactive maintenance of company assets and work equipment Stock control of the office and warehouse including placing supplier orders Undertake any required tasks related to the renewal of subscriptions and accreditations and updating of documents

Essential skills;



Strong HR experience, great with people, personable and empathetic but assertive when needed Techie! A keen eye for detail with business operating systems and processes with the ability to spot bottlenecks and a natural ability to find ways of improving efficiency Super organised and on the ball, taking action of things that need doing without delay Proficient administration and IT skills such as using spreadsheets and all other microsoft packages including sharepoint Overseeing adherence and certification assessments for company accreditations such as ISO9001 quality management and CHAS health and safety Meticulous and very thorough, ensuring high standards throughout the business Team leadership including training and holding people accountable for their key deliverables Excellent communication, written and verbal You must be confident to lead a team and set a good example
